Christina Cook, four-year-old daughter of Rich and Tami Cook of Kalona was selected as a state finalist in the Miss Iowa American Coed Pageant, set for September 4-6 in Des Moines.
The Pageant is for girls ages 3 through 17, each competing within their own age division. Winners receive cash awards, full modeling scholarships, official crowns and banners and transportation to Disney World in Florida to compete for the national title.
Cook attends Sunrise Childcare, Inc., in Wellman and studies dance with Dana Smith in Kalona.
She will participate in the art, photogenic, model and talent competition, as well as evening wear, introduction and interview in the petite-princess division of the competition.
She is the granddaughter of Joyce Donham, Iowa City, Harold Poggenpohl, Bellevue and Kathy Cook of Washington. Her great-grandmother is Erma Manning of Washington.
Sponsors are R. C. Insulation, J M Construction & Landscaping, Top Knotch Antique Repair and Restoration as well as family members and friends.
